On , OSHA opened a planned safety inspection of U.S. DEPT. OF AGRICULTURE - FOREST SERVICE in 19777 GREENLEY ROAD, SONORA, CA 95370 (NAICS 924120). OSHA activity number 340616796.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1904.10(a): The employer did not record all cases on the OSHA 300 Log when an employee's hearing test (audiogram) revealed that the employee had experienced a work-related Standard Threshold Shift (STS) in hearing in one or both ears, and the employee's total hearing level is 25 decibels (dB) or more above audiometric zero (averaged at 2000, 3000, and 4000 Hz) in the same ear(s) as the STS: Stanislaus National Forest: The employer did not ensure that an employee who suffered a work-related standard threshold shift was recorded on the OSHA 300 Log.

29 CFR 1910.146(c)(1): The employer did not evaluate the workplace to determine if any spaces were permit-required confined spaces: Stanislaus National Forest: The employer did not evaluate the forest to determine if there were any permit-required confined spaces.

29 CFR 1910.146(c)(2): The employer did not inform exposed employees, by posting danger signs or by any other equally effective means, of the existence and location of and the danger posed by the permit spaces: Stanislaus National Forest: The employer did not ensure signage identifying and warning employees about the permit-required confined spaces had been posted.

29 CFR 1910.147(c)(1): The employer did not establish a program consisting of an energy control procedure, employee training and periodic inspections to ensure that before any employee performed any servicing or maintenance on a machine or equipment where the unexpected energizing, startup or release of stored energy could occur and cause injury, the machine or equipment shall be isolated from the energy source and rendered inoperative: Stanislaus National Forest: The employer had not established an energy control program which included information on machine specific procedures and awareness and authorized personnel training.
